Last year's rules were:
  • Contest will run from Free-DC.org midnight [GMT] update for August 1st 2010 to midnight update for August 31st 2010.

  • To be eligible for the Prize, you must achieve 50,000 BOINC points within the contest time frame (31 days).

  • Eligible points must be achieved under a user name crunching for team TechPowerUp! (#22175)http://www.worldcommunitygrid.org/team/viewTeamInfo.do?teamId=S8TLJ6TFV1 only.

  • Eligible winning member cannot hold a Top 75 position on the TechPowerUp! WCG Team prior to contest.

  • To enter contest you must state your intent to participate and provide username on this thread.

  • Open to all Residents of the Planet Earth except Antartica. Contest is void where prohibited. This contest is not sanctioned by W1zzard or TechPowerUp! and they shall be held harmless of any liability.

  • Winner will be randomly selected within 5 days of contest ending and contacted via private message or e-mail address registered with TechPowerUp!
